Output 90efd07c43758a1380339d5c97a8d1c2262f1042f79af98c0e9975cbe391887f:1

value
64573
script pubkey
OP_0 OP_PUSHBYTES_20 50fb4500ca4b232c803e4ba484792fac67d13c21
address
bc1q2ra52qx2fv3jeqp7fwjgg7f043naz0ppaqvxxx
transaction
90efd07c43758a1380339d5c97a8d1c2262f1042f79af98c0e9975cbe391887f
confirmations
132190
spent
true